For New York-based interior designer Sherill Canet, the past is something to be recreated with relish and ambition. The decorator takes her cues from disparate periods, regions, and artifacts to craft an unmistakably refined aesthetic: eighteenth century French and English antiques, chinoiserie, painted furniture, Art Deco, the glamour of the Gilded Age, and the mansions that once dotted the Gold Coast of Long Island, New York - a region Canet also calls home - are all incorporated. Illustrated with principal photography by Michel Arnaud, A La Carte brings together Canet's work and commentary to create an exclusive tutorial on decorating in a range of elegant styles, from Old World traditional to chic and tailored. Contains over 200 color illustrations. Whether your library is a modern den or a gentleman's English country retreat, Canet's advice on choosing the room's essential elements is always keen - with comfort and function in mind. Incorporating a love of antiques and fine detail into all of her projects, Sherrill Canet creates gracious and comfortable settings which mix the old with the new, giving her clients' homes a classic and timeless appeal. Canet attended the Inchbald School of Design in London and graduated with a Bachelor of Science degree in Economics from Fordham University.
